Latest Patents

Greg Collins holds a patent for a high temperature corrosion sensor. This sensor features a housing with an external wall and an internal wall, creating a chamber. It includes a stainless steel tube and a ceramic tube, with a portion of the ceramic tube inserted into the stainless steel tube. Additionally, it has an airflow tube extending through the chamber and a sensor probe that incorporates multiple electrodes and a thermocouple. This invention provides methods for measuring corrosion within a power plant environment.
